Brennan Company (Brennan) is seeking an experienced Marine Construction Project Manager to lead technically complex infrastructure projects throughout the Midwest, with opportunities spanning from Duluth, Minnesota to St. Louis, Missouri. We are looking for a proven leader with experience managing heavy civil and marine construction projects, including deep foundations, bridge construction, dock and barge terminal structures, dam construction, and railroad infrastructure.

Our projects require strong planning, operational leadership, and the ability to coordinate work performed on or over water in challenging environments. The ideal candidate has successfully managed complex construction projects, partnered closely with field teams, subcontractors, and clients, and thrives in fast‑paced, technically demanding marine construction settings while maintaining a strong commitment to safety, quality, and project performance.

Responsibilities
  • Lead full lifecycle management of marine and heavy civil infrastructure projects executed on or overwater
  • Develop and manage detailed project work plans, cost structures, baseline schedules, and recovery schedules
  • Oversee deep foundation operations, including pile driving (steel, concrete, timber), drilled shafts, cofferdams, and sheet piling systems
  • Manage marine logistics including barges, cranes, floating equipment, specialty access systems, and sequencing of work over navigable waterways
  • Direct coordination between field leadership, engineering teams, subcontractors, and owners
  • Maintain strict financial control including forecasting, cost tracking, productivity analysis, change management, and monthly owner billing
  • Prepare and negotiate change orders and contract modifications in accordance with public infrastructure contract requirements
  • Review and approve submittals, shop drawings, lift plans, and engineered marine work plans
  • Support pursuit efforts including bid reviews, quantity takeoffs, pricing strategy, and risk evaluation
  • Interface with public agencies including DOTs, USACE, rail authorities, port authorities, and municipal owners
  • Travel to active marine construction job sites up to 75% of the time as required
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management, or related technical field
  • Minimum 5+ years of project management experience in marine or heavy civil infrastructure (not commercial building construction)
  • Demonstrated leadership experience managing projects involving:
    • Bridge substructures and superstructures
    • Dam rehabilitation
    • Dock and barge terminal construction
    • Railroad infrastructure and rail bridge work
    • Deep foundation systems and pile‑supported structures
  • Strong working knowledge of marine construction methods including work from floating platforms and temporary work in water
  • Experience managing public infrastructure contracts with complex specifications and regulatory requirements
  • Advanced understanding of scheduling (Primavera P6 or MS Project), cost control, forecasting, and contract management
  • Proven ability to lead field teams in high‑risk, technically demanding marine environments
  • Strong communication skills with the confidence to interface with owners, engineers, inspectors, and executive leadership
